Cigarettes After Sex Bio

Cigarettes After Sex is an American ambient pop band formed in El Paso, Texas in 2008. The current members of the band are Greg Gonzalez on lead vocals, electric guitar, acoustic guitar, and bass, Randall Miller on bass, and Jacob Tomsky on drums. In 2011 they produced their first demo self-titled Cigarettes After Sex (Romans 13:9). They followed that up the next year with their debut EP titled I. The group gained a following online and started performing around Europe, Asia, and the United States. In 2017 they released their debut full-length studio album self-titled Cigarettes After Sex. Their song “Nothing’s Gonna Hurt Your Baby” has been featured in the television shows The Sinner, Wanderlust, The Handmaid’s Tale, and Shameless. Their song “K” was featured in the television show Killing Eve.
